How Concrete Water Damage Restoration Actually Works

A proper process is crucial with concrete water damage restoration. Cutting corners can lead to further damage, costly repairs, and even safety hazards. Our team follows a meticulous process that ensures every detail is addressed. Here’s a step-by-step breakdown of what you can expect:

Step 1: Moisture Detection and Assessment

We use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and assess the extent of the damage. This helps us identify areas that need attention and focus on the restoration process. Our team will also check for any signs of structural damage or other hidden issues.

Step 2: Containment and Preparation

We set up containment barriers to prevent further water damage and protect your belongings. This includes moving furniture, securing loose items, and covering floors to prevent moisture from spreading. Our team will also prepare the area for drying, including removing any wet insulation or debris.

Step 3: Drying and Evaporation

We use specialized equipment to promote evaporation and drying. This includes industrial fans, dehumidifiers, and drying mats that help speed up the process. Our team will also use moisture sensors to monitor progress and adjust the equipment as needed.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

We th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ent mold growth and bacterial contamination. This includes using eco-friendly cleaning products and sanitizing solutions to remove any remaining moisture and debris.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Repair

We conduct a final inspection to ensure the area is dry and safe. If necessary, we’ll make any repairs or replacements to ensure your home’s foundation is secure. Our team will also provide you with a detailed report and recommendations for future maintenance.

Warning Signs You Need Concrete Water Damage Restoration

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ore the warning signs, they can show a more serious issue is brewing: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ant smells can be a sign of mold growth or bacterial contamination. If you notice persistent odors in your basement or crawl space, it’s time to act fast. Our team can help you identify the source and take corrective action.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Visible water stains or discoloration on walls or floors can show water damage. These signs can be a sign of a larger issue, such as a leaky pipe or poor drainage. Our team can help you diagnose the problem and provide a solution.

Warped or Buckled Floors

Warped or buckled floors can be a sign of water damage or structural issues.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s essential to address the issue quickly. Our team can help you restore your floors to their original condition.

Visible Water Leaks

Visible water leaks can be a sign of a more serious issue. If you notice water dripping from walls, ceilings, or pipes, it’s essential to act fast. Our team can help you diagnose the problem and provide a solution.

Swollen or Cracked Walls

Swollen or cracked walls can be a sign of water damage or structural issues. If you notice any changes in your walls, it’s essential to address the issue quickly. Our team can help you restore your walls to their original condition.

Excessive Humidity

Excessive humidity can be a sign of water damage or poor ventilation. If you notice high humidity levels in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ly. Our team can help you diagnose the problem and provide a solution.

Concrete Water Damage Restoration Cost In Barnstable, MA

The cost of concrete water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Barnstable, MA. These estimates are based on our experience and should be used as a rough guide only: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Moisture Detection and Assessment $200 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of damage
Containment and Preparation $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of containment required
Drying and Evaporation $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of drying equipment required
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ning products required
Final Inspection and Repair $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of repairs required
